Output 66f420a77e89b394875dbbde602ee5dbee234ffb5b46323fe0c7f40ad41703b6:38

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d7c2f192993fa4dfbd4c44cfa4569f35930559a30653a13e1dd50f14b567ca53
address
bc1p6lp0ry5e87jdl02vgn86g45lxkfs2kdrqef6z0sa6583fdt8effs8y6url
transaction
66f420a77e89b394875dbbde602ee5dbee234ffb5b46323fe0c7f40ad41703b6
spent
true